Information about #ECC4FE color
Basic facts about this digital color
The color #ECC4FE reads as a maximally vivid violet and glows at the very top of the lightness scale. Designers typically reach for tones like this for airy backdrops, whitespace-heavy designs and gentle gradients. In The Official Register of Color Names it is practically indistinguishable from Light Lilac (#EDC8FF). Nearby in the Register you will also find Pale Mulberry (#F0C2FF) and Light Lavendar (#EFC0FE).
Technically, the mix leans on its blue channel (rgb(236, 196, 254)), which gives #ECC4FE its character. On this background, black text reaches a 13.9:1 contrast ratio (passing WCAG AAA); white stays at 1.5:1. No one has named #ECC4FE so far. Register a name for it and it becomes a permanent record.

#ECC4FE color harmonies
Color harmonies are pleasing color schemes created according to their position on a color wheel.
Complementary
Complementary color schemes are made by picking two opposite colors con the color wheel. They appear vibrant near to each other.
Split complementary
Split complementary schemes are like complementary but they uses two adiacent colors of the complement. They are more flexible than complementary ones.
Analogous
Analogous color schemes are made by picking three colors that are next to each other on the color wheel. They are perceived as calm and serene.
Triadic
Triadic color schemes are created by picking three colors equally spaced on the color wheel. They appear quite contrasted and multicolored.
Tetradic
Tetradic color schemes are made form two couples of complementary colors in a rectangular shape on the color wheel.
Square
Square color schemes are like tetradic arranged in a square instead of rectangle. Colors appear even more contrasting.
